Put rubber is becoming a popular choice for play ground surfacing due to its combination of efficiency, eco-friendliness, and low maintenance.
Safety is the most essential aspect when selecting playground emerging, and put rubber excels in this area. The product is created to absorb impact, minimizing the threat of injury when children fall from equipment like swings, slides, and climbing up structures. Standard options like wood chips, sand, or gravel can shift or compact gradually, leaving spaces or uneven areas that can result in mishaps. Poured rubber, however, is seamless, offering a smooth, constant surface area that helps protect kids from falls, no matter how high the play devices is.
Toughness is another reason why poured rubber is an outstanding option for play ground appearing. Unlike other materials that require frequent replenishing or upkeep, put rubber stays undamaged and resistant to wear and tear. It can endure heavy foot traffic, extreme weather, and consistent usage without degrading. This makes it ideal for high-traffic playgrounds, schools, and parks where resilience is important. Furthermore, the rubber surface area does not fade, fracture, or shift, keeping its stability for several years.
Put rubber is also a highly sustainable option for playground surfacing. Many poured rubber products are made from recycled materials, such as tires, helping to decrease waste and support environmental efforts. The water-permeable nature of poured rubber enables rainwater to go through, minimizing the danger of puddles or muddy locations after a storm. This keeps the play area surface area safe and dry, ensuring it remains usable despite weather.
One of the standout benefits of poured rubber is its low maintenance requirements. Once installed, the surface requires very little care, conserving money and time for center supervisors or play area owners. There's no requirement for frequent raking or replacing, as with wood chips or sand. The smooth, durable nature of poured rubber means that the surface area remains undamaged, providing long-lasting security for users.
